About 03 Numbers

Many organizations utilize 03 numbers instead of the more costly 08 numbers. For example, many public sector bodies have transitioned from 0845 numbers to 0345. The cost of calls is the same as calls to geographic numbers (01 or 02). The cost of calls depend on the time of the day, and most providers offer call packages that allow calls free of charge at specific times of the day. Mobile call costs vary depending on the chosen calling plan. Generally, these calls are incorporated in free call packages.
